From Prevention to Diversion: The Role of Afterschool in the Juvenile Justice System

Thu, Jun 4, 2020

From Prevention to Diversion: The Role of Afterschool in the Juvenile Justice System

In the United States, involvement with the juvenile justice system can have a long-lasting negative impact on a person’s life. When youth are placed in detention facilities, their education, ties to society, and lives are disrupted; yet any involvement with the justice system—regardless of incarceration—can have implications for one’s future career and educational opportunities.

Wired to Learn: Social and Emotional Development in Adolescence

Thu, Apr 30, 2020

Wired to Learn: Social and Emotional Development in Adolescence

Recent developments in brain science have shown that adolescence is a crucial time for influencing social, emotional, and cognitive growth. In adolescence, the brain is particularly well-suited to acquire social and emotional competencies that are vital for youth to navigate the world, and yet we often see a fall-off in participation in youth development programs during this time.
